Autobahn WebSocket Testsuite Report
Autobahn WebSocket

Boost.Beast/189-Async - Case 13.5.7 : Pass - 789 ms @ 2018-11-09T16:45:16.115Z

Case Description

Send 1000 compressed messages each of payload size 16384, auto-fragment to 0 octets. Use permessage-deflate client offers (requestNoContextTakeover, requestMaxWindowBits): [(True, 8)]

Case Expectation

Receive echo'ed messages (with payload as sent). Timeout case after 480 secs.

Case Outcome

Ok, received all echo'ed messages in time.

Expected:
{}

Observed:
[]

Case Closing Behavior

Connection was properly closed (OK)



Opening Handshake

GET / HTTP/1.1

User-Agent: AutobahnTestSuite/0.8.0-0.10.9

Host: 127.0.0.1:8081

Upgrade: WebSocket

Connection: Upgrade

Pragma: no-cache

Cache-Control: no-cache

Sec-WebSocket-Key: Qg9J1LVxHhjEYO85F1uK2w==

Sec-WebSocket-Extensions: permessage-deflate; client_no_context_takeover; client_max_window_bits; server_no_context_takeover; server_max_window_bits=8

Sec-WebSocket-Version: 13
HTTP/1.1 101 Switching Protocols

Upgrade: websocket

Connection: upgrade

Sec-WebSocket-Accept: Qzj8JMzA9HKk3tH0sy7UGZpczY4=

Sec-WebSocket-Extensions: permessage-deflate; server_no_context_takeover; client_no_context_takeover; server_max_window_bits=9

Server: Boost.Beast/189-Async


Closing Behavior

KeyValueDescription
isServerFalseTrue, iff I (the fuzzer) am a server, and the peer is a client.
closedByMeTrueTrue, iff I have initiated closing handshake (that is, did send close first).
failedByMeFalseTrue, iff I have failed the WS connection (i.e. due to protocol error). Failing can be either by initiating closing handshake or brutal drop TCP.
droppedByMeFalseTrue, iff I dropped the TCP connection.
wasCleanTrueTrue, iff full WebSocket closing handshake was performed (close frame sent and received) _and_ the server dropped the TCP (which is its responsibility).
wasNotCleanReasonNoneWhen wasClean == False, the reason what happened.
wasServerConnectionDropTimeoutFalseWhen we are a client, and we expected the server to drop the TCP, but that didn't happen in time, this gets True.
wasOpenHandshakeTimeoutFalseWhen performing the opening handshake, but the peer did not finish in time, this gets True.
wasCloseHandshakeTimeoutFalseWhen we initiated a closing handshake, but the peer did not respond in time, this gets True.
localCloseCode1000The close code I sent in close frame (if any).
localCloseReasonNoneThe close reason I sent in close frame (if any).
remoteCloseCode1000The close code the peer sent me in close frame (if any).
remoteCloseReasonNoneThe close reason the peer sent me in close frame (if any).


Wire Statistics

Octets Received by Chop Size

Chop SizeCountOctets
414
2881288
121111211
121222424
121611216
123222464
123311233
123911239
124211242
124611246
124911249
125033750
125111251
125211252
125411254
125611256
125722514
125822516
126011260
126311263
126511265
126711267
127211272
127422548
127511275
127811278
127911279
128245128
128311283
128433852
128522570
128711287
128922578
129122582
129233876
129433882
129511295
129645184
129733891
129811298
130022600
130122602
130222604
130333909
130511305
130633918
130711307
130822616
130933927
131022620
131111311
131211312
131311313
131411314
131511315
131711317
131922638
132011320
132122642
132233966
132322646
132411324
132611326
132722654
132811328
132911329
133122662
133211332
133411334
133711337
133811338
133934017
134056700
134356715
134434032
134522690
134611346
134822696
135011350
135211352
135711357
135811358
135922718
136011360
136111361
136322726
136434092
136511365
136656830
136711367
136822736
136922738
137022740
137122742
137211372
137322746
137522750
137634128
137722754
137856890
137934137
138122762
138222764
138322766
138411384
138545540
138611386
138734161
138834164
138945556
139022780
139234176
139311393
139456970
139556975
139611396
139722794
139934197
140134203
140222804
140334209
140411404
140534215
140611406
140722814
140811408
140911409
141034230
141111411
141222824
141334239
141411414
141545660
141634248
141745668
141845672
141945676
142011420
142179947
142234266
142322846
142545700
142622852
142711427
142922858
143045720
143122862
143234296
143311433
143557175
143622872
143711437
143857190
143922878
144022880
144134323
144311443
144411444
144534335
144634338
144722894
144834344
144934347
145034350
145168706
145234356
145322906
145445816
145522910
145622912
145711457
145822916
145934377
146022920
146134383
146245848
146357315
146445856
146534395
146622932
146768802
1468710276
146957345
147045880
147168826
147211472
147357365
147468844
147568850
147668856
147734431
147811478
147911479
148022960
148122962
148222964
148311483
148457420
148557425
148645944
148722974
148811488
148945956
149111491
149322986
149445976
149545980
149668976
149745988
149845992
149957495
150034500
150123002
150257510
150346012
150411504
150534515
150623012
150746028
150823016
150911509
151011510
151157555
151269072
151311513
151446056
151546060
151669096
151723034
151846072
151923038
152011520
1521710647
152234566
152323046
152411524
152523050
152711527
152823056
152911529
153011530
153223064
153311533
153411534
153534605
153634608
153723074
153811538
153923078
154023080
154111541
154223084
154323086
154523090
154611546
154811548
154911549
155111551
155234656
155311553
155611556
155911559
156011560
156123122
156211562
156346252
156511565
156711567
156811568
156934707
157211572
157311573
157423148
157511575
157734731
157811578
157934737
158011580
158111581
158311583
158523170
158611586
159011590
159311593
159611596
159711597
159834794
159911599
160011600
160123202
160211602
160311603
160411604
160523210
160611606
160723214
160923218
161111611
161211612
161311613
161434842
161611616
161711617
161823236
161911619
162011620
162123242
162234866
162323246
162411624
162611626
163034890
163134893
163211632
163411634
163511635
163611636
163911639
164034920
164111641
164211642
164511645
164611646
164911649
165511655
165734971
165811658
166111661
166346652
166411664
166511665
166623332
166711667
166911669
167135013
167223344
167411674
167523350
167735031
167823356
167911679
168011680
168111681
168211682
168311683
168411684
168558425
168811688
168923378
169623392
169911699
170023400
170135103
170235106
170323406
170635118
170711707
170811708
170935127
171011710
171123422
171311713
171411714
171511715
171646864
172011720
172235166
172311723
172611726
173311733
173711737
173835214
173923478
174011740
174311743
174711747
174811748
175211752
175311753
175611756
175811758
175923518
176211762
176935307
177711777
177811778
178111781
178311783
178511785
178611786
178711787
179011790
179211792
179323586
179458970
179535385
179723594
179823596
179923598
1800610800
180111801
1802610812
180311803
180423608
180511805
180635418
181023620
181123622
181223624
181335439
181511815
181611816
181711817
181811818
182111821
182235466
182411824
182511825
182723654
182811828
183111831
183211832
183323666
183411834
183523670
183635508
183711837
183811838
183923678
184023680
184123682
184311843
184411844
184511845
184711847
185111851
185211852
185411854
185611856
185711857
185911859
186011860
186311863
187111871
187211872
187311873
187411874
187611876
188011880
188111881
188211882
188511885
188723774
188911889
189023780
189211892
189411894
189723794
189911899
190235706
190411904
190623812
190711907
190911909
191111911
191523830
191623832
191711917
191923838
192111921
193311933
193611936
193711937
193811938
193911939
194211942
194611946
194711947
194823896
194923898
195011950
195111951
195211952
195411954
195511955
195611956
195711957
195811958
196111961
196223924
196611966
196823936
196911969
197323946
197435922
197511975
197623952
197711977
198623972
198711987
199523990
199911999
200012000
200212002
200312003
200412004
201012010
204412044
204612046
204812048
204912049
205024100
205312053
Total10021553177

Octets Transmitted by Chop Size

Chop SizeCountOctets
818
3921392
7141714
7181718
72021440
72153605
72232166
72342892
72442896
72553625
72642904
72796543
72864368
729118019
730107300
73196579
732139516
73364398
73475138
7351511025
7361410304
737118107
73853690
739118129
74042960
74185928
74253710
74332229
74475208
74542980
74632238
74842992
74921498
75032250
75121502
75243008
75332259
75421508
75521510
75621512
75753785
75821516
75921518
76021520
76175327
76232286
76353815
76443056
76553825
76643064
76764602
76853840
76943076
77075390
77164626
77264632
77396957
77486192
77521550
77632328
77775439
77875446
77975453
78021560
78175467
78275474
78353915
78486272
78521570
78632358
78721574
78832364
78932367
7901790
79175537
79232376
79321586
79421588
7951795
79632388
79753985
79832394
79932397
80032400
80132403
8021802
8031803
80421608
80554025
80654030
8071807
80832424
80932427
81021620
8111811
8121812
8131813
8141814
81543260
81643264
81832454
81943276
8211821
82264932
82321646
82421648
82532475
82632478
82721654
82821656
8291829
83043320
83143324
83221664
8331833
83443336
83521670
83643344
83754185
83843352
83932517
84054200
84165046
84265052
84365058
84486752
84565070
84675922
84721694
84854240
84943396
85032550
85143404
85232556
85332559
85421708
8551855
8561856
85721714
85821716
85921718
86143444
86254310
86454320
86521730
86621732
86743468
86843472
8691869
87076090
87132613
87232616
87365238
8741874
87543500
87621752
87743508
87921758
88054400
8821882
8831883
88465304
88543540
88621772
8871887
8881888
8891889
89032670
89121782
8921892
89321786
89421788
8951895
89632688
8971897
8981898
8991899
90032700
90121802
90221804
90332709
90465424
90532715
90632718
90732721
90921818
9101910
9111911
91221824
91321826
91454570
91532745
91676412
91754585
91865508
91932757
92021840
92132763
92232766
92365538
92465544
92543700
92643704
92754635
92865568
92932787
93054650
93187448
93232796
93343732
93432802
93554675
93665616
93732811
93854690
93943756
94032820
94187528
94254710
94376601
94443776
94532835
94632838
94754735
94876636
94943796
95043800
95143804
95232856
95354765
95421908
95543820
9561956
95765742
95865748
95965754
9601960
96132883
96265772
9631963
96432892
96543860
96643864
96765802
96843872
96943876
9711971
9721972
9731973
9741974
9751975
97621952
97754885
9781978
9801980
98121962
9821982
9831983
9841984
98521970
98632958
9891989
99021980
9911991
9921992
9931993
9941994
99521990
9971997
9991999
100322006
100422008
100811008
101122022
101911019
Total1002841244

Frames Received by Opcode

OpcodeCount
11000
81
Total1001

Frames Transmitted by Opcode

OpcodeCount
11000
81
Total1001


Wire Log

000 TX OCTETS: 474554202f20485454502f312e310d0a557365722d4167656e743a204175746f6261686e5465737453756974652f302e382e
               302d302e31302e390d0a486f7374 ...
001 RX OCTETS: 485454502f312e312031303120537769746368696e672050726f746f636f6c730d0a557067726164653a20776562736f636b
               65740d0a436f6e6e656374696f6e ...
002 WIRELOG DISABLED
003 CLOSE CONNECTION AFTER 480.000000 sec
004 WIRELOG ENABLED
005 TX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ASK=3cdc2cc5, PAYLOAD-REPEAT-LEN=None, CHOPSIZE=None, SYNC=False
               0x03e8
006 TX OCTETS: 88823cdc2cc53f34
007 RX OCTETS: 880203e8
008 RX FRAME : OPCODE=8, FIN=True, RSV=0, PAYLOAD-LEN=2, MASKED=False, MASK=None
               0x03e8
009 TCP DROPPED BY PEER